7 Steps to plan your breakfast

1. Plan your breakfast the previous day, so that you can keep the ingredients ready to save time in the morning.

{ad3}

2. Planning ahead also increases the options you have, because you will have time to soak, grind or ferment batters.

3. Choose recipes that use ingredients available at home or at least easily available in local shops.

4. During the weekend, make a list of 7 items that you can make for the 7 days of the week so that you do not have to waste time every day on deciding the menu. This will also help you to finish your ingredients shopping at one go.

5. Theplas can be made in advance and used for 2 to 3 days. There are also some dishes like Aloo Paratha that can be prepared and stored in the deep-freezer, to cook and serve easily in the mornings.

6. You can also prepare and deep-freeze some common ingredients like mashed potatoes.

Getting things ready for a paratha

• Make the dough at night and keep it ready in fridge.
• If the recipe uses potatoes, boil them, cool and store in the fridge.

{ad7}
• If you are taking the parathas along to eat later, then keep the packing materials ready. You can even pack the chutney or curds in the respective containers and stow them into the fridge, so that you can just pop them into your bag in the morning.

Planning ahead for idlis and uttapas

• Prepare the batter.
• Make coconut chutney, coriander chutney or tomato chutney the previous night and store in the fridge. Take it out first thing in the morning so that it will be at room temperature when you eat.

• If you are making sambhar, pressure-cook the dal and keep it in the fridge the previous night itself. If you are really hard-pressed for time, then you can even make the sambhar the previous night and refrigerate. Heat and serve in the morning.

All set for making upma

• Chop the veggies and keep them ready.
• You can roast the rava, cool it and store in an airtight container. If you are dry-roasting the rava, you can store it at room temperature, else if you have roasted with oil or ghee, store it in the fridge.
